Parameter.Type Propiedad

Definición

Obtiene o establece el tipo del parámetro.Gets or sets the type of the parameter.

public:
 property TypeCode Type { TypeCode get(); void set(TypeCode value); };
public TypeCode Type { get; set; }
member this.Type : TypeCode with get, set
Public Property Type As TypeCode

Valor de propiedad

Tipo de la propiedad Parameter.The type of the Parameter. El valor predeterminado es Object.The default value is Object.

Excepciones

El tipo de parámetro no es ninguno de los valores de TypeCode.The parameter type is not one of the TypeCode values.

Ejemplos

En el ejemplo de código siguiente se muestra cómo DefaultValueestablecer Typelas propiedades Direction , y Parameter de los objetos cuando se usan como parámetros de salida y parámetros de valor devuelto con un procedimiento almacenado.The following code example demonstrates how to set the DefaultValue, Type, and Direction properties of Parameter objects when using them as output parameters and return value parameters with a stored procedure. Este ejemplo de código forma parte de un ejemplo más extenso proporcionado SqlDataSourceStatusEventArgs para la información general de la clase.This code example is part of a larger example provided for the SqlDataSourceStatusEventArgs class overview.

<asp:sqldatasource
    id="SqlDataSource1"
    runat="server"
    datasourcemode="DataSet"
    connectionstring="<%$ ConnectionStrings:MyNorthwind%>"
    selectcommand="getordertotal"
    onselected="OnSelectedHandler">
    <selectparameters>
      <asp:querystringparameter name="empId" querystringfield="empId" />
      <asp:parameter name="total" type="Int32" direction="Output" defaultvalue="0" />
      <asp:parameter name="_ret" type="Int32" direction="ReturnValue" defaultvalue="0" />
    </selectparameters>
</asp:sqldatasource>
<asp:sqldatasource
    id="SqlDataSource1"
    runat="server"
    datasourcemode="DataSet"
    connectionstring="<%$ ConnectionStrings:MyNorthwind%>"
    selectcommand="getordertotal"
    onselected="OnSelectedHandler">
    <selectparameters>
      <asp:querystringparameter name="empId" querystringfield="empId" />
      <asp:parameter name="total" type="Int32" direction="Output" defaultvalue="0" />
      <asp:parameter name="_ret" type="Int32" direction="ReturnValue" defaultvalue="0" />
    </selectparameters>
</asp:sqldatasource>

Comentarios

El tipo se puede usar para crear parámetros fuertemente tipados, de modo que los valores se conviertan correctamente entre la aplicación web y el código subyacente.The type can be used to create strongly typed parameters, so that values are converted correctly between your Web application and underlying code.

Si se cambia el tipo del parámetro, se llama OnParameterChanged al método.If the type of the parameter is changed, the OnParameterChanged method is called.

Se aplica a

Consulte también: